/**
* This function will fill a SOCKETADDRESS structure from an InetAddress
* object.
*
* The parameter 'sa' must point to valid storage of size
* 'sizeof(SOCKETADDRESS)'.
*
* The parameter 'len' is a pointer to an int and is used for returning
* the actual sockaddr length, e.g. 'sizeof(struct sockaddr_in)' or
* 'sizeof(struct sockaddr_in6)'.
*
* If the type of the InetAddress object is IPv6, the function will fill a
* sockaddr_in6 structure. IPv6 must be available in that case, otherwise an
* exception is thrown.
* In the case of an IPv4 InetAddress, when IPv6 is available and
* v4MappedAddress is TRUE, this method will fill a sockaddr_in6 structure
* containing an IPv4 mapped IPv6 address. Otherwise a sockaddr_in
* structure will be filled.
*/
JNIEXPORT int JNICALL
NET_InetAddressToSockaddr(JNIEnv *env, jobject iaObj, int port,
SOCKETADDRESS *sa, int *len,
jboolean v4MappedAddress);
